KAMPALA - Five men, including two boda-boda operators, have been charged before the General Court Martial (GCM) at Makindye in Kampala with murder, aggravated robbery and attempted murder following the killing of a police officer in Mukono district.

The accused are;

▪️Labison Amutuhire,  a boda doda operator of  Namataba Ward in Bweyogerere in Wakiso, is also known as Robinson alias Mulefu 

▪️Arafat Kasango, a boda-boda operator from Kito ‘A’ village, Kirinya Ward in Wakiso

▪️Alfonsi Daniel, a bricklayer from Kapeke village, Kasenge Parish, Nama Sub- County in Mukono district

▪️Daniel Okello Oyara, 25, a casual labourer from Kireku Zone, Bweyogerere in Wakiso

▪️Joseph Innocent Luyirika, a casual labourer from Tula Road in Kawempe Division, Kampala

The five, who denied the charges, appeared before a panel of three, chaired by Col Frederick Kangwamu, assisted by Col Nasser Drago Igambi and Maj Abubaker Nyombi.

Capt Gift Mubehamwe, from prosecution, said that investigations were still ongoing, and requested court for an adjournment to April 1, 2026. He also asked court to remand the accused to Kitalya Government Prison.

The defence team, led by Capt Daniel Kagombe, informed court that they intend to invoke Article 23(6)(a) of the Constitution to apply for bail in the near future.

The charge

Prosecution alleges that on or around November 23, 2025, at Ntawo Cell in Ntawo Ward, Mukono District, the accused, with malice aforethought, unlawfully caused the death of Assistant Superintendent of Police (ASP) Emmanuel Bagenda.

They are also accused of robbing Police Constable Jackson Kiyingi of a rifle (serial number 56582735135369) and 30 rounds of ammunition on the same date and at the same location.

It is further alleged that at or immediately after the robbery, the accused were in possession of deadly weapons, including SMG rifles with serial numbers UPDF 48014855 and UG PSO 564211739.

In a third count, the accused are charged with attempted murder, with prosecution alleging that they attempted to unlawfully cause the death of PC Kiyingi during the same incident.

The case was adjourned to April 1, 2026, for mention.
